A Revolutionary Period in Surgery: The Advancement of Minimally Invasive Techniques

The modern operating room is a far cry from the large incisions and extended hospital stays that characterized surgery a century ago.

Today’s operating physicians are progressively using procedures that lower tissue injury and conserve the inherent body structure.

Key to these surgical advances are micro-invasive and muscle-sparing procedures.

Micro-invasive surgery refers to techniques that use small incisions, specialized instruments, and high-definition imaging to access and treat internal conditions with minimal disruption to surrounding tissues.

On the other hand, muscle-sparing surgery focuses on preserving the integrity of muscle tissue during procedures that traditionally required more extensive muscle dissection.

Each method aligns with a wider initiative to decrease patient morbidity, suffering, and recuperation time.

A Historical Review: Transitioning from Open Surgery to Tissue Preservation

Surgical practices have long been dictated by necessity and available technology.

Before the advent of modern imaging and instrumentation, physicians had little choice but to execute large open incisions to ensure adequate exposure and reach the target site.

While crucial for survival, these approaches often imposed marked postoperative pain, drawn-out recoveries, and risks of complications such as infectious issues or chronic muscle debilitation.

The transformation initiated with laparoscopic surgery's advent in the late 20th century—a minimally invasive technique that unlocked internal visualization with a tiny camera via small incisions.

As technology evolved, practitioners discerned that preserving the integrity of muscle tissue during operations could result in even more pronounced benefits.

Muscle-sparing techniques, initially developed in orthopedics and cardiovascular surgery, soon found applications in abdominal, gynecological, and oncological procedures, among others.

The Principles Behind the Techniques

Micro-Invasive Surgery: Precision Through Technology
At the core of micro-invasive surgery is the principle of precision.

Surgeons use an array of high-tech tools—from endoscopes and robotic-assisted PLLC. devices to specialized microscopes—to navigate the human body through minuscule openings.

These devices provide amplified magnification and superior lighting, allowing for precise localization and treatment in the target area with minimal collateral tissue damage.

A significant development has been the combination of robotic-assisted platforms with surgical procedures.

These platforms allow surgeons to operate with unprecedented steadiness and accuracy, filtering out natural hand tremors and translating subtle movements into fine, controlled actions.

In interventions such as prostatectomies and cardiac procedures, the high precision consistently results in optimal patient outcomes.

Cardiothoracic Procedures: Reducing Cardiac Injury

Heart and thoracic surgeries have greatly prospered from micro-invasive methods.

Procedures such as valve repairs and coronary artery bypass grafting (CABG) have traditionally required large incisions and extensive dissection of muscle tissue.

Today, surgeons increasingly employ minimally invasive techniques that use small incisions and specialized instruments to access the heart and surrounding structures.

The adoption of robotic-assisted systems in cardiothoracic surgery has further refined these procedures.

Frequently, the robotic system affords the requisite precision to execute subtle maneuvers on the moving heart, minimizing complications and hastening recovery.

A comparative study published in the Annals of Thoracic Surgery found that patients undergoing minimally invasive valve repairs had lower rates of postoperative atrial fibrillation and shorter hospital stays compared to those who underwent conventional surgery.

General and Gynecologic Procedures: Improving Patient Results.

Within general and gynecologic surgery, minimally invasive methods have revolutionized operations like gallbladder removal, hernia repair, and hysterectomy.

The evolution toward using limited incisions and preserving muscle tissue not only cuts down on scarring but also lessens postoperative discomfort and the possibility of complications.

For instance, the laparoscopic removal of the gallbladder (cholecystectomy) via small incisions has become the norm in many areas.

Patients gain from shortened recuperation imp source periods and the swift ability to return to everyday activities.

In gynecology, muscle-sparing techniques have been instrumental in improving outcomes for women undergoing complex procedures such as myomectomies or pelvic floor repairs.

A review of clinical outcomes in a leading medical journal noted that minimally invasive gynecologic surgeries result in lower rates of infection and blood loss, along with improved cosmetic outcomes.

These enhancements not only increase patient satisfaction but also foster improved overall health results.

Limitations and Hurdles: A Realistic Outlook.

Despite the numerous advantages, micro-invasive and muscle-sparing techniques are not without challenges.

One significant limitation is the steep learning curve associated with these advanced methods.

Practitioners are required to engage in intensive training and accrue considerable experience before executing these procedures at par with conventional surgery.

Significant initial investments in both technology and training can impede the adoption of these methods in resource-limited contexts.

In addition, not all patients meet the criteria for these minimally invasive approaches.

In cases where extensive disease or anatomical complexities are present, traditional open surgery may still be the safest and most effective option.

Surgeons must carefully assess each case, balancing the potential benefits of minimally invasive techniques against the specific needs of the patient.

Technical limitations also play a role.

Even with state-of-the-art equipment, there can be instances where the operative field is limited, or unexpected complications arise, necessitating conversion to an open procedure.

These scenarios, while relatively rare, highlight the importance of having a versatile surgical team that is prepared to adapt to changing circumstances.

The Future of Surgery: Trends and Innovations.

Embracing AI-Driven and Robotic Solutions.

Even though modern minimally invasive and muscle-preserving methods have revolutionized surgery, forthcoming advancements are poised to be even more transformative.

The integration of artificial intelligence (AI) and machine learning into surgical systems is poised to further enhance precision and efficiency.

Such systems can evaluate large datasets in real time, providing surgeons with predictive insights to optimize decision-making during sophisticated procedures.

For instance, AI-powered imaging solutions are being developed to automatically underscore essential anatomical structures, thereby diminishing the risk of accidental injury.

Robotic platforms are also evolving, with next-generation systems offering even finer control and enhanced haptic feedback, which allows surgeons to "feel" the tissue they are operating on—a feature that traditional laparoscopic instruments lack.

Expanding the Boundaries of Minimally Invasive Surgery.

Research and development in the field of tissue engineering and regenerative medicine are likely to intersect with surgical innovations.

Scientists are exploring ways to not only minimize tissue damage but also promote faster, more natural healing.

This includes the use of bioengineered scaffolds that can support tissue regeneration and reduce scar formation after surgery.

Moreover, as imaging and sensor technology continue to improve, surgeons may be able to perform procedures that are even less invasive than those currently available.

Innovations such as nanorobots and miniature, implantable devices could one day allow for targeted therapy and diagnostics at a cellular level, ushering in a new era of truly personalized medicine.
